1 The surface S is defined for all real x and y by the equation z = x 2 + 2xy . The intersection of
S with the plane P gives a section of the surface. On the axes provided in the Printed Answer
Booklet, sketch this section when the equation of P is each of the following.

(a) x = 1 [2]

(b) y = 1 [2]



2 A curve has equation y = 1 + x 2 , for 0 G x G 1, where both the x- and y-units are in cm. The
area of the surface generated when this curve is rotated fully about the x-axis is A cm2.
1
(a) Show that A = 2r y 1 + kx 2 dx for some integer k to be determined. [4]
0

A small component for a car is produced in the shape of this surface. The curved surface area of
the component must be 8 cm2, accurate to within one percent. The engineering process produces
such components with a curved surface area accurate to within one half of one percent.

(b) Determine whether all components produced will be suitable for use in the car. [2]

5 (a) The group G consists of the set S = "1, 9, 17, 25, under # 32 , the operation of multiplication
modulo 32.

(i) Complete the Cayley table for G given in the Printed Answer Booklet. [2]

(ii) Up to isomorphisms, there are only two groups of order 4.
• C4, the cyclic group of order 4
• K4, the non-cyclic (Klein) group of order 4
State, with justification, to which of these two groups G is isomorphic. [2]

(b) (i) List the odd quadratic residues modulo 32. [2]

(ii) Given that n is an odd integer, prove that n 6 + 3n 4 + 7n (mod 32). [4]

7 Binet’s formula for the nth Fibonacci number is given by Fn = 1 ^ n
5
a - b nh for n H 0 , where a
and b (with a 2 0 2 b ) are the roots of x 2 - x - 1 = 0 .

(a) Write down the values of a + b and ab . [1]

(b) Consider the sequence "S n, , where S n = a n + b n for n H 0 .

(i) Determine the values of S2 and S3. [3]

(ii) Show that S n + 2 = S n + 1 + S n for n H 0 . [2]

(iii) Deduce that S n is an integer for all n H 0 . [1]

(c) A student models the terms of the sequence "S n, using the formula Tn = a n .

(i) Explain why this formula is unsuitable for every n H 1. [1]

(ii) Considering the cases n even and n odd separately, state a modification of the formula
Tn = a n , other than Tn = a n + b n , such that Tn = S n for all n H 1. [2]
